    1. Ebony Simpson

    Ebony Jane Simpson was murdered in Bargo, New South Wales on 19 August 1992. She was only nine years old. After an extensive search involving over 300 people, officers arrested a local man, Andrew Garforth and questioned him. It took less than fifteen minutes for him to admit to abducting Ebony whilst she was walking home from school.

    2. Peter Norris Dupas

    Peter Norris Dupas is one of Australia's most prolific serial killers. His vicious attacks on women started at the age of 15, and eventually resulted in the brutal murder and mutilation of three innocent women. This is the story of his depraved murders, and the unconventional trail that followed.

    3. The Port Arthur Tragedy

    One of the deadliest rampages of the 20th century, Martin Bryant was convicted of murdering 35 people and injuring 21 others in the Port Arthur massacre. His crime drastically altered the countries gun laws, and left the world shocked.

    5. Derek Percy

    Derek Percy was imprisoned for the murder of 12 year old Yvonne Elizabeth Tuohy, after abducting her from a Victorian beach in July 1969, though a successful plea of insanity found him not-guilty of the crimes. Percy's crimes are much debated, and police suspect him of several more unsolved brutal murders.

    6. Kathryn Mary Knight

    Katherine Mary Knight was the first ever Australian woman to be sentenced to life imprisonment without parole in 2001. The gruesome slaying of her de facto husband, John Price, rocked the small town of Aberdeen and the rest of the country. It is still considered one of the worst cases of domestic violence ever seen.
